I'm trying to combine a low-resolution image with a high-resolution one with immerge with the following parameters:
Code: Select all
in = high_res.im,low_res.im
out = merged.im
factor = 1.
options = notaper
Upon running immerge on my Apple M1 silicon laptop (Monterey 12.3.1) with miriad version 20220505, the resultant image is non-sensical. Miriad was installed using a binary installation following the instructions under "Install Miriad using binary installation on a Mac". The resulting image looks like (on a 90% scale with a pixel flux range over 5-6 orders of magnitude):
As a check I ran the immerge on our server (miriad version 20211230) , as well as on WSL (Ubuntu 20.) on my personal laptop (miriad version 20220505). Both produced the desired results being:
Any ideas what may/may not be happening? Apologies if I haven't included any information.

Just playing about with the non-sensical output from miriad's immerge on my M1, using the following python script:
Code: Select all
import numpy as np
from astropy.io import fits
import matplotlib.pylab as plt
fitsfile = 'merged.im.fits' # Non-sensical output of immerge as a fits
with fits.open(fitsfile) as hdul:
data = hdul[0].data[0] # Take 1st frequency channel as an example
img = np.fft.ifft2(data).real # Inverse Fourier transform the image
plt.close('all')
plt.imshow(img.real, vmin=0, cmap='plasma')
plt.savefig('immerged_ifft.png')
plt.show()
The resulting image is:
- immerged_ifft.png (145.15 KiB) Viewed 40845 times
From that image, it looks like there are two copies of the desired (I think?) result concatenated along the image x-axis. The left hand image appears inverted around the x-axis wrt the right hand image.

it turns out this is a problem we've seen before - and it was fixed in January. What version does you immerge report when you run it?
I get: immerge: Revision 1.9, 2022/01/12 03:58:09 UTC
I tried this version and it seems to do the right thing.
